About S. J. Perry
S. J. Perry is a scholar working on Control and Systems Engineering, Mechanical Engineering, Renewable Energy, Sustainability and the Environment, Automotive Engineering and Industrial and Manufacturing Engineering, having authored 43 papers that have together received 2.2k indexed citations. Recurring topics across this work include Process Optimization and Integration (20 papers), Thermodynamic and Exergetic Analyses of Power and Cooling Systems (12 papers), Advanced Control Systems Optimization (12 papers), Carbon Dioxide Capture Technologies (4 papers), Refrigeration and Air Conditioning Technologies (4 papers), Energy Efficiency and Management (4 papers), Vehicle emissions and performance (3 papers) and Municipal Solid Waste Management (3 papers). The work is most often cited by research in Control and Systems Engineering (875 citations), Energy Engineering and Power Technology (103 citations), Renewable Energy, Sustainability and the Environment (278 citations), Mechanical Engineering (627 citations) and Environmental Engineering (240 citations). S. J. Perry has collaborated with scholars based in United Kingdom, Czechia and Malaysia. Frequent co-authors include Jiří Jaromír Klemeš, Robin Smith, Chew Tin Lee, Igor Bulatov, Yee Van Fan, Jin‐Kuk Kim, Luís Puigjaner, Kamran Raissi, V.R. Dhole and Oscar Aguilar. Their work appears in journals such as Applied Thermal Engineering, Process Safety and Environmental Protection, Applied Energy, Journal of Environmental Management and AIChE Journal.
